About 9 Hyperion Court
9 Hyperion Court is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Ipswich (IP1 5AJ). It has a recorded floor area of 60 m² (around 646 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2003-2006 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(June 2021)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 90).
Across 2008–2021, sale prices on this property compounded at 1.3%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£288/sq ft) was about 58.2%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: October 2021 at £186,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
